The regulatory spine: licenses, insurance, and permits

Every plumbing contractor in California appearing jobs of 500 funds or extra in labor and parts needs to dangle an energetic C‑36 Plumbing license with the Contractors State License Board. That license way they exceeded alternate and legislation checks and maintain bonding. But here is the capture: the license belongs to the business and the qualifying man or woman, not both employee on the truck. You wish to know who's supervising your process and no matter if the qualifier is in fact engaged in operations. Ask, listen, and ensure the license on line. If the manufacturer identify the shop clerk makes use of does now not suit the CSLB checklist, sluggish down.

Insurance is nonnegotiable. At a minimal, seek typical liability that covers estate spoil and physically harm. In California’s denser neighborhoods, a small mishap can improve. I actually have observed a soldering task light insulation, cause sprinklers in a apartment stack, and ship water down 4 floors. The proper coverage grew to become a disaster into a controlled claims activity. Without it, the owner could had been in a lawsuit limbo. Workers’ reimbursement protects you if a tech gets hurt on your home. Do not receive the road that each one their plumbers are “self sustaining” and as a result now not staff. If they handle the schedule, offer the resources, and put on guests shirts, they probable need policy cover.

Permits are unevenly enforced. San Francisco will demand allows for and inspection for so much hid paintings and frequently even water heater swaps, whereas a few unincorporated regions give more leeway. The plumber need to take the lead on makes it possible for. If they ask you to drag the enable as an proprietor-builder for their comfort, ask why. Owner-builder permits can expose you to added legal responsibility. A self-assured contractor will deal with the bureaucracy, time table inspections, and thing that point into the bid.

How California’s water and strength law shape your job

California drives aggressive efficiency codes. Your new furniture needs to meet low-drift criteria. Tankless water warmers customarily make feel here when you consider that common fuel quotes and area constraints choose them, despite the fact that the initial run may possibly comprise upgrading fuel strains or venting. Electric warmness pump water heaters are gaining flooring as some towns prohibit new gasoline infrastructure. A true-rated plumber will not push you in the direction of one expertise on commission, however will run the numbers to your precise domestic: water hardness, fuel service length, electric panel ability, vent routes, and the manner your family members genuinely uses scorching water.

Drought cycles accentuate the point of interest on leakage. A faucet drip appears to be like small, yet a slab leak in a 1970s ranch can waste tens of heaps of gallons before you see a spike on the utility invoice. I have watched thermal imaging and acoustic leak detection save a homeowner from needless jackhammering. The larger contractors possess this tools and recognize find out how to use it. They do no longer bet. They scan, affirm, after which open the floor.

Backflow prevention is one more California wrinkle. Many cities require annual testing for positive assemblies. If you have got irrigation, a pool, or a fireplace sprinkler tie-in, ensure that your contractor is familiar with neighborhood backflow policy. Top department shops preserve qualified testers on workforce. That saves the anxious cycle of calling a separate corporation simply to publish a scan record.

Regional realities: why pricing and observe differ across California

California shouldn't be one market. A dwelling in Sacramento with a raised basis gives distinctive get right of entry to than a slab-on-grade tract domicile in Riverside. Labor bills are better in coastal metros. City charges for makes it possible for and inspections can upload a couple of hundred funds in San Jose and masses greater if highway paintings is concerned in Los Angeles. Earthquake shutoff valves are regularly occurring necessities in countless jurisdictions after you change or relocate gas home equipment. A pro contractor will mention these local mandates without being triggered.

Soil subjects. In the Central Valley, expansive clay soils generally rigidity underground strains. In older Bay Area neighborhoods, it's possible you'll uncover brittle transite or orangeburg sewer laterals that have outlived their meant existence. Trenchless chances like pipe bursting or cured-in-region piping can safeguard landscaping and hardscape, but they may be not magic wands. You need ok host pipe circumstance and area for launch pits. A in truth desirable-rated organization explains the ones constraints, now not just the upside.

How to study estimates like a pro

Plumbing estimates are a mix of drapery, labor, and risk. Ask for a scope it's special approximately:

  • The certain fixture units, pipe material, and valve versions being used
  • Whether wall, tile, or slab fix is covered or excluded
  • Permit expenditures, inspection scheduling, and who is responsible
  • Warranty phrases for both parts and labor
  • Conditions for unforeseen considerations and the way difference orders are priced

That one quick record will preserve so much surprises in assess. When two bids seem alternative by using 30 percentage, dig into supplies. One contractor may possibly specify PEX-A with enlargement fittings and a dwelling-run manifold, at the same time an extra plans a extra normal trunk-and-branch design or copper type L. Each frame of mind has benefits. Copper resists UV and has a long track file, yet in parts with aggressive water chemistry it is going to broaden pinholes. PEX handles bends and should be quicker to put in in tight spaces, yet wishes UV upkeep and cautious routing to dodge destroy right through drywall paintings. A brilliant plumber will outline the commerce-offs, now not just claim one subject matter top-quality in all circumstances.

Warranty, apply-by using, and what it truely covers

Many vendors promote lifetime warranties yet prohibit them to parts protected with the aid of the producer. Labor is the place your check lies. Ask for a plain rationalization: if a blending valve fails within two years, do you pay for the discuss with, the alternative, each, or neither? For trenchless sewer work, warranties occasionally canopy the lining itself for a decade or extra, yet not root intrusions at unlined tie-ins. I even have noticed a home-owner misunderstand this and count on the accomplished lateral was once lower than guarantee whilst in simple terms a section was. A conscientious contractor will map the blanketed limits and come up with the guaranty certificates, no longer just a line at the bill.

Follow-up responsiveness is as really good because the promise. Call the office every week after crowning glory with a minor query and notice how they respond. You will study extra in that two-minute call than in a sleek brochure.

Budget levels possible without a doubt use

Numbers waft all around the net, oftentimes without context. Here are simple degrees from latest tasks I even have noticed across California, with the information that situations pass these up or down. A common water heater alternative for a essential tank unit commonly lands among 1,500 and three,000 cash based on metropolis rates and venting. Tankless installations run from three,500 to 6,500 bucks whilst gasoline and vent improvements are faded, and might reach 9,000 if panel work or long vent runs are wished. Whole-domestic repipes in a normal 1,500 rectangular foot domicile run from 7,000 to 18,000 greenbacks depending on fabric, get admission to, and patching. Main sewer line rehabilitations with trenchless strategies normally fall among 6,000 and 15,000, with avenue paintings and faucets adding radically if vital. Hydro jetting a main line is traditionally four hundred to one,2 hundred money depending on get right of entry to and severity. If a quote sits a long way open air those stages, ask what is special approximately your site or scope.
